SHIPPING NEWS.
(Over-sea Arrivals at Wellington.) September 11th—Papanui, s.s., froui Loudon. September 12ti>, Aparima, from Calcutta. September 15th Kumaia from London. September 15th Burgermeister from New York. Ocean-going Steamers for Wellington. Tongario, due Hbout September 25th, sailed from Plymouth August 11th, via Capetown and Hobart. (N.Z.B. Co.) Mimiro, duo about Soptember 26th, sailed from Loudon July 22nd, via Australia, Auckland, and Napier. (lyser). Willesden, uue about September 30th, sailed from New York' July 7th via Australia and Auckland. (N.Z.S. Co). Cornwall, due about October 2nd, flailed from New York July 19th, via Australia and Auckland. (N.Z. and A. Co.) Somerset, due about October 3rd, sailed from Liverpool July 21st via Australia and Auckland. (N.Z. and A. Co.} Aymerio, due about Octooer 4th, sailed from I\ew York August sth, via Auoklaad. Pakeha, due about October sth, sailed from London August 4th, via Auoklaad. (Shaw, Savill). Banffshire, due about Ootober sth, sailed from Duroan, via Austrialia. (N.Z. and A. Co.) lonic, due about October 10th, sailed from Plymouth August 25th via Capetown and JHobact. (Shaw, Savill). ~ Suffolk, due about October 10th, ■ sailed from Liverpool August 18th, t via Auckland. (N.Z. and A. Co). Courtfield, due about Ootober 20th sailed from New York August, sth via Australia and Auckland. Star of New Zealand, due about Ootober 27th, sailed from Liverpool Auguafi 19th, via Auckland. (Tyaer). Wimbledon, due about 30th, sailed from New York August 25th, via Auckland. (N.Z. an c ! A Co). Sailing Vessels. Australia, ship, sailed from Liverpool June 9th. Daniel, barque, sailed! from Clarence river September 2nd.
